WebNov 10, 2006 · from a Date/Time field: datSomeDate = Date(Me.txtMyDateAndTime) timSomeTime = Time(Me.txtMyDateAndTime) A Date/Time Field set only to the Date should show a time of Midnight. A Date/Time Field set only to Time will show that time with a date of Dec. 30, 1899. Larry Linson Microsoft Access MVP
